Bu makale makine çevirisi ayna makalesidir, orijinal makaleye geçmek için lütfen buraya tıklayın.

Görünüm: 12487|Yanıt: 1

[Kaynak] PoorMans Free SQL Server Database T-SQL Formatter

[Bağlantıyı kopyala]
Yayınlandı 9.04.2022 14:48:25 | | | |
Fakir Adam'ın T-SQL Formatlayıcısı

Bu, ücretsiz ve açık kaynaklı bir SQL (T-SQL) formatlayıcısıdır:

  • Depolanan prosedürler, tetikleyiciler gibi nesne tanım betikleri dahil olmak üzere tam çoklu toplu betikleri yönetin.
  • Farklı yaygın format stilleri/standartlarına uyacak biçimlendirme seçenekleri sunulmaktadır
  • İsteğe bağlı olarak sadece biçimlendirilmiş SQL değil, "renkli" HTML kodu çıkarabilirsiniz
  • Kodunuzu güzelce yazdırmak yerine kafanızı karıştırmak için yorumları ve boşlukları kaldırmak için "çıkarıcı" seçeneği de mevcuttur
  • Kullanıma hazır modeller çeşitli formatlarda mevcuttur
  • SSMS (SQL Server Management Studio) ve mevcut dosyayı veya seçilen metni tek bir kısayot tuşu ile biçimlendirmenize olanak tanıyan Visual Studio eklentileri/uzantıları - SSMS veya SSMS Express'in herhangi bir sürümü ile Visual Studio'nun tam (Express olmayan) herhangi bir sürümü için destek sağlar.
  • Favori evrensel metin düzenleyicinizde hızlı bir tıklamayla biçimlendirme için Notepad++ eklentisi.
  • İstediğiniz kadar dosyayı toplu formatlamaya veya başka herhangi bir programdan - windows (.Net) veya herhangi bir ortam (node/npm) için - biçimlendirme sağlayan komut satırı aracı
  • Winforms uygulaması sayesinde kolay çevrimdışı biçimlendirme (ayrıca token akışlarını ve ayrıştırma ağaçlarını görüntüleme imkanı verir)
  • SQL dosyalarını karşılaştırmadan önce otomatik biçimlendirmek için kullanılan WinMerge eklentisi, WinMerge'ın yalnızca içerik değişikliklerini göstermesine izin verir, biçimlendirme farklılıklarını görmezden gelir.
  • Aynı işlevselliğe sahip bir JS kütüphanesini herhangi bir tarayıcıda veya diğer Javascript tabanlı bağlamlarda çevrimiçi demo/formatlama siteleri için ortaya çıkarınBağlantı girişi görünür.
  • Ayrıca .Net 2.0/3.5 kütüphanesi olarak da mevcuttur, buradan veya NuGet üzerinden indirilebilir
  • C# ile yazılmış, takılabilir tasarıma sahip olan diğer SQL lehçeleri gelecekte desteklenmelidir

Resmi Web Sitesi:Bağlantı girişi görünür.
GitHub adresi:Bağlantı girişi görünür.
Online SQL Formatlama:Bağlantı girişi görünür.
Poor Man's T-SQL Formatter, Visual Studio, SSMS, Notepad++ ve diğer eklentilere sahiptir; bunlar SSMS eklentisini örnek olarak alarak diğer araçlarla iyi miras alınabilir; indirme adresi:Bağlantı girişi görünür.

PoorMansTSqlFormatterSSMSPackage.Setup.1.6.16.msi (692 KB, İndirme sayısı: 0, 售价: 3 粒MB)

Yerel olarak kurdumSQL Server Management Studio version: 15.0.18390.0, aşağıdaki şekilde gösterildiği gibi:



SQL Server 2016, kurulum tamamlandıktan sonra yönetici bir araç (SSMS) içermez
https://www.itsvse.com/thread-8281-1-1.html

PoorMansTSqlFormatterSSMSPackage.Setup.1.6.16 yüklemeden önce,PC'ye .NET Framework 2.0 çalışma zamanının yüklenmesi gerekiyor, aksi takdirde hata şu şekilde olur:



Kurulum adımlarını kurmak için, kontrol panelinden Windows fonksiyonlarını etkinleştirin veya kapatın ve aşağıdaki şekilde gösterildiği gibi kurulum kontrol kutusunu işaretleyin:



PoorMansTSqlFormatterSSMSPackage.Setup.1.6.16 tekrar yüklendikten sonra, Microsoft hatası şöyledir:


---------------------------
Microsoft SQL Server Management Studio
---------------------------
"FormatterPackage" paketi doğru şekilde yüklenemedi.
Bu sorun, yapılandırma değişikliği veya başka bir uzantı yüklemesinden kaynaklanabilir. Detaylar için "C:\Users\itsvse_pc\AppData\Roaming\Microsoft\AppEnv\15.0\ActivityLog.xml" dosyasına bakabilirsiniz.
Visual Studio'yu yeniden başlatmak bu sorunu çözmeye yardımcı olabilir.
Bu hata mesajını sürekli mi gösteriyor?
---------------------------
Evet(Y) Hayır(N)   
---------------------------

Çözüm: Kurulum dizinini açın, örneğin: C:\Program Files (x86)\Microsoft SQL Server Management Studio 18\Common7\IDE klasörü, düzenleSsms.exe.configAşağıdaki belgeler eklenmiştir:



Microsoft SQL Server Management Studio 18 aracını tekrar açın, artık hata bildirmeyin ve aşağıdaki şekilde gösterildiği gibi bir SQL ifadesi girin:



Tools -> Format T-SQL Code veya kısayol Ctrl+K, F(F'ye tıklamadan önce Ctrl'yi serbest bırakmanız gerekiyor), biçimlendirilmiş renderasyonlar aşağıdaki gibidir:



(Son)





Önceki:Angular, ebeveyn tıklama olayının tetiklenmesini engeller
Önümüzdeki:【Pratik yap】iPhone mesaj bildirimi push için Bark uygulaması
 Ev sahibi| Yayınlandı 13.03.2025 14:02:53 |
SQL İsteri: SQL'inizi kolayca yazın, biçimlendirin, analiz edin ve yeniden yapılayın (Ücretli

https://www.red-gate.com/products/sql-prompt/
Feragatname:
Code Farmer Network tarafından yayımlanan tüm yazılım, programlama materyalleri veya makaleler yalnızca öğrenme ve araştırma amaçları içindir; Yukarıdaki içerik ticari veya yasa dışı amaçlarla kullanılamaz, aksi takdirde kullanıcılar tüm sonuçları ödemelidir. Bu sitedeki bilgiler internetten alınmakta olup, telif hakkı anlaşmazlıklarının bu siteyle hiçbir ilgisi yoktur. Yukarıdaki içeriği indirmeden sonraki 24 saat içinde bilgisayarınızdan tamamen silmelisiniz. Programı beğendiyseniz, lütfen orijinal yazılımı destekleyin, kayıt satın alın ve daha iyi orijinal hizmetler alın. Herhangi bir ihlal olursa, lütfen bizimle e-posta yoluyla iletişime geçin.

Mail To:help@itsvse.com